Three dimensions that decide the answer

One: can the ground be built on — the setback exists before the design

The Alquist-Priolo Earthquake Fault Zoning Act of 1972 (Public Resources Code §2621 et seq.) states its purpose plainly: to assist cities, counties and state agencies in prohibiting the location of developments and structures for human occupancy across the trace of active faults (§2621.5(a)). At the implementation level, 14 CCR §3603(a) is more specific still. No structure for human occupancy may be placed across the trace of an active fault, and the area within 50 feet of an active fault is presumed to be underlain by active branches of that fault unless a geologic investigation prepared to the required standard proves otherwise.

Note which way that sentence runs. The burden of proof sits with the applicant. The default position is that you may not build, and it is your money that pays for the investigation — trenching included — that rebuts the presumption. The town does not have to produce evidence of why you cannot.

On top of state law, the hill towns add their own layer. Woodside's town geologic map legend distinguishes four kinds of fault: San Andreas traces that ruptured in 1906, San Andreas traces active outside 1906, the Hermit fault of undetermined activity, and the Pilarcitos fault, determined to be inactive. The General Plan 2012 Natural Hazards and Safety Element then sorts the whole town into four zones — fault (F, covering the setback area around mapped traces and adjacent ground at risk of surface rupture), slope instability (S, covering mapped landslides and adjacent slopes that may be unstable), expansive bedrock (E, covering mapped Whiskey Hill Formation bedrock, which can contain highly expansive clay beds) and general constraint (A) — and publishes the 50-foot and 125-foot setbacks. The sentence in that document leaves no room: no structure for human occupancy is permitted within an active fault zone.

Portola Valley got there earlier. The town's own account of its history runs like this: in the late 1960s and early 1970s Stanford geologists mapped the San Andreas traces through the town, the town appointed its first Town Geologist in the same period, and a town ordinance then established fault setback requirements town-wide, graded by how precisely the fault location is known. (For the specific distances, rely on the current ordinance text and the Town Geologist's determination.) The system has teeth. The town's Housing Element — adopted in January 2015 and archived by the California Department of Housing and Community Development — records that the town's geology is mapped at a scale of 1 inch = 500 feet and that the Town Geologist reviews every development application within a geologic hazard area. The same document carries a case in point: Blue Oaks, a 30-lot hillside subdivision bisected by the San Andreas, took roughly 10 years to move from concept to final map approval, of which some five to seven years went into the applicant disputing the town's geologic conclusions and pursuing designs inconsistent with the general plan.

The most telling detail is what the town did to itself. In the Town Center rebuild, the town administration building was reconstructed on its original site — but deliberately placed behind the earthquake fault setback. The town's geologic safety committee had concluded on the public record that the 1906 surface rupture did pass through the Town Hall site and will do so again; only the when, the where and the form remain uncertain. A town that applies the setback to its own town hall does not keep a side door open for private parcels.

Los Altos Hills sits differently, but not more comfortably. The town's Safety Element, adopted in 2007, records that neither the San Andreas nor the Calaveras crosses town limits, while three fault lines identified as potentially active — Berrocal, Altamont and Monte Vista — do. The same document notes that because the terrain is steep and the soils relatively weak, the ground motion a given earthquake produces here can exceed what neighboring communities experience. So in Los Altos Hills the question has to be asked at the zone level: which hazard zone does this parcel fall in, and what does the town require to be submitted for that zone?

Two: will the house hold — liquefaction and landslide run on a different statute

This is the layer most often skipped. Alquist-Priolo governs one thing: surface fault rupture. Liquefaction, earthquake-induced landslide and strong-motion amplification belong to the Seismic Hazards Mapping Act of 1990 (PRC §2690 et seq.), under which the State Geologist maps seismic hazard zones. Two map series, two statutes, two separate judgments.

The operative clause is PRC §2697(a): a city or county shall require a geotechnical report defining and delineating the hazard before approving a project located within a seismic hazard zone, unless prior studies of adjacent, comparable ground establish that no such excessive hazard exists. In institutional terms, that report is a condition precedent to approval. It sits ahead of the approval action, and it has to be cleared first.

For the hill towns this is concrete. Among the seismic hazard zone maps noticed by the California Department of Conservation in October 2018 and released after the public review and revision process, the Woodside quadrangle covers Portola Valley, Woodside and surrounding ground: alluvial flats extending toward San Francisco Bay and portions of the San Andreas rift zone are mapped as zones requiring investigation for liquefaction, while the Santa Cruz Mountains slopes are mapped as zones requiring investigation for earthquake-induced landslide. Portola Valley's own planning documents are candid about it: nearly the entire western portion of the town lies within the earthquake-induced landslide hazard area, with a further meaningful share affected by liquefaction — and liquefaction, in most cases, has an engineering solution, provided the project can carry the cost.

So inside the due diligence window, the geologic and geotechnical file should be read in a particular order:

  • Start with the scope statement on the conclusions page. A geotechnical report is written for one specific design. If the seller's report was prepared for a set of addition drawings from ten years ago, it reaches no conclusion about your scheme.
  • Then read the recommended measures as line items of capital cost. Piers, soldier piles, ground replacement, drainage systems — these are the other face of "it can be solved," and they belong in your total budget. On a hillside parcel this line commonly opens in six figures.
  • Then check which zones the site falls in. Fault setback, mapped landslide, expansive bedrock (Woodside's Whiskey Hill Formation clay is broken out as its own category on the official map) and liquefaction each imply a different engineering response and a different approval path.
  • Finally, go to the town's files. Los Altos Hills retains soils reports in town records as a historical account of site conditions, and Portola Valley and Woodside both hold site-level material. These documents are rarely in the MLS attachment package. You have to ask.

There is a counterintuitive point here too: town review is triggered by scope of work plus zone, and has nothing to do with how grand the house is. Woodside splits the question in two — first, does this scope require a geotechnical report; second, which zone is it in, and does it therefore require a separate geologic peer review. Under the town's current Geotechnical / Soils Reports Required and Geotechnical Peer Review Requirements Matrix (the document is marked updated 9-19-2013): a new residence, a retaining wall of any size, and grading above 1,000 cubic yards each require both a report and peer review across all four zones. Grading of 100 to 1,000 cubic yards requires a report, with peer review always in the S and E zones and at the Town Engineer's discretion in F and A. Additions above 250 square feet require a report, with peer review always in F and waived below 500 square feet in the other three zones. Pools and spas require a report, with peer review in S and E. Below 100 cubic yards, whether a report is required is decided by the Town Engineer, Town Geologist or Building Official based on type, location and design.

Earth-moving volume also pulls a second, entirely separate thread. Under the town's Site Development Permit Guidelines, cut, fill and stockpiling totaling more than 100 cubic yards — or fill more than 3 feet in vertical depth, or cut more than 4 feet — requires a site development permit. And under Municipal Code §151.22, combined cut and fill above 1,500 cubic yards, or cut or fill deeper than 8 feet, goes to the Planning Commission. Geotechnical report, geologic peer review and Planning Commission review are three independent gates, and a scheme that turns the garage into a gym and adds a pool can trip all three at once. Portola Valley's published referral list is likewise organized by action — site development permits, foundation repair or replacement, pools, building permits subject to Alquist-Priolo, building permits within fault or slope zone setbacks or within a flood zone, and new residences plus additions above a stated size all go to the Town Geologist (with the specific thresholds per the town's current published text).

Three: who absorbs the loss — earthquake is a separate policy, and the high deductible is structural

Clear the common misunderstanding first: a standard California homeowners policy does not cover earthquake damage. That is the starting point of the whole regime, not one carrier's preference. California Insurance Code §10081 provides that every insurer issuing, delivering or (for policies in force on the operative date) first renewing a residential property policy in this state shall offer the named insured coverage for the peril of earthquake, either by endorsement or as a separate policy.

Section 10083 sets the timing and the form of that offer. It may be made before, at the same time as, or within 60 days after the policy is issued or renewed, and if delivered by mail it goes to the mailing address on the policy or application. The statute also prescribes the bold-face notice text that must be used. Two of its sentences matter most to a buyer: "Your homeowners insurance policy does not provide coverage for loss caused by an earthquake to your dwelling or its contents," and the warning that if you do not accept the offer within 30 days of the notice being mailed, your insurer will presume that you did not accept it.

Silence counts as rejection. That clock deserves its own line in your closing calendar, because it usually starts running during the weeks you are busy moving.

Then the structural question. A California Earthquake Authority policy carries a deductible expressed as a percentage of the Coverage A limit — the dwelling's rebuilding cost — at 5%, 10%, 15%, 20% or 25%. Under CEA's current published terms, a home with a Coverage A limit above $1,000,000 (as well as a pre-1980 wood-frame home on a non-slab foundation without verified retrofitting) may only select 15%, 20% or 25%.

Run that against hill-town price levels. On a dwelling insured for $4M of rebuilding cost, a 15% deductible is $600,000 — the amount you carry yourself before the policy pays anything. Note that the rebuilding-cost limit is not the purchase price, and is usually well below it, since land is not rebuilt. Even so, for most families that number is a significant cash arrangement in its own right. Which is why, at this price level, "should we buy earthquake insurance" usually resolves into two different questions: can we self-insure that deductible, and do the limits and terms of a non-CEA commercial earthquake or difference-in-conditions program fit this house's rebuilding cost better?

The frame of reference is worth stating as well. Under the USGS Third Uniform California Earthquake Rupture Forecast (UCERF3, 2015), the probability of an M6.7 or greater earthquake somewhere in the San Francisco Bay Area over the thirty years from 2014 to 2043 is roughly 72%. That is the regional background rate. It is not particular to any one hill town.

What the three towns closed last quarter, and why contract time matters

The headline numbers first. In the second quarter of 2026, Woodside recorded 31 single-family closings at a $4.50M median, 74.2% of them all cash, with a median 21 days on market. Portola Valley recorded 21 closings at a $3.60M median, 23.8% all cash, median 18 days on market. Los Altos Hills recorded 32 closings at a $5.725M median, 34.4% all cash, and a median of just 9 days on market. Sale-to-original-list ratios came in at 97.3%, 98.4% and 97.5% respectively — all three below 100%.

Town 2026 Q2 single-family closings Median close price All cash Median days on market Close / original list
Woodside 31 $4.50M 74.2% 21 days 97.3%
Portola Valley 21 $3.60M 23.8% 18 days 98.4%
Los Altos Hills 32 $5.725M 34.4% 9 days 97.5%

What to take from this. Nearly three quarters of Woodside's closings were all cash. In that market most transactions have no lender, no appraiser and no underwriter reviewing the ground under the house, which means every check has to be written into the contract by the buyer. And a 9-day median in Los Altos Hills means that by the time you are deciding whether to write, there is effectively no time left to pull town files or book a geologic consultant. That work belongs before the showing, not inside the due diligence window.

Common mistakes

Mistake one: "The house is inside an Alquist-Priolo fault zone, so nothing can be built."

Not so. What the Act prohibits is placing a structure for human occupancy across the trace of an active fault (PRC §2621.5(a)); at the implementation level, 14 CCR §3603(a) presumes the ground within 50 feet of that fault to be underlain by active branches. A presumption can be rebutted by a qualified geologic investigation — which is precisely why trenching exists. So the right question breaks into three: where on this parcel does the trace run, how large and what shape is the buildable area once the setback is applied, and what extra grading and engineering cost does putting the house inside that area impose? Those three answers together set the value of the land. They do far more than decide whether you sign a disclosure form.

Mistake two: "The NHD report says not in a fault zone, so the geology is fine."

That is not what it says. The Natural Hazard Disclosure Statement (Civil Code §1103.2) and PRC §2621.9 require disclosure of whether the property sits inside a state-mapped zone. It is a yes/no question, and it answers a mapping conclusion, not a site condition. Three gaps are worth holding on to. First, Alquist-Priolo covers surface rupture only; liquefaction and earthquake-induced landslide belong to the separate map series under the Seismic Hazards Mapping Act. Second, town-level mapping is often far finer than the state's — Portola Valley maps at 1 inch = 500 feet, and information at that scale does not survive into a checkbox. Third, PRC §2621.9(d) itself provides that where map accuracy or scale is not sufficient to allow a reasonable person to determine whether the property is within a fault zone, the agent shall mark "yes" on the statement. The checkbox concedes the limits of its own resolution. Disclosure resolves knowledge; due diligence resolves decisions. For what a seller is legally obliged to write down, and which defects have to go in, see Selling a Bay Area House — Which Problems Must Go Into the Disclosures, and Can a Buyer Sue Me If I Leave One Out?

Mistake three: "It's a full acre, so it's obviously big enough for the house I want."

Area and buildability are two different variables. Fault setbacks (in Woodside, 50 feet from a known fault and 125 feet from an inferred one), mapped landslides and the unstable slopes adjacent to them, expansive bedrock zones, and grading and slope thresholds each remove a share of the buildable ground — and they tend to overlap on the flattest, prettiest piece, the one where you instinctively want to put the house. The correct sequence on hill-town land is to confirm with the town which geologic zones the parcel falls in and how the setback is drawn, then let the architect place a scheme inside what remains. Not to draw the scheme first and go back asking for an exception.

Mistake four: "Earthquake is covered under homeowners, isn't it?"

It is not. The reason Insurance Code §10081 compels insurers to offer earthquake coverage when they issue, deliver or first renew a residential property policy is precisely that the standard policy does not include it. The first line of the statutory notice under §10083 reads: "Your homeowners insurance policy does not provide coverage for loss caused by an earthquake to your dwelling or its contents." Read the back half too — the same notice states that if you do not accept the offer within 30 days of it being mailed, the insurer will presume you did not accept. Missing one letter therefore lands directly on your coverage: the offer is treated as declined, and you stay by default on the uninsured side.

Mistake five: "I'm paying cash, so I can skip the geotechnical report."

Paying cash removes the lender, not the risk — and removing the lender also removes a layer of third-party review that was already thin here: 74.2% of Woodside's second-quarter 2026 closings were all cash. The more practical point is that the geologic conclusion will keep reappearing at every later step. PRC §2697 requires a city or county to obtain a geotechnical report before approving a project within a seismic hazard zone, so if you ever intend to add on, dig a basement, build a pool or move earth, that report is going to be produced eventually. The only question is whether it gets produced while you still hold negotiating leverage inside the due diligence window, or after you have paid and the scheme comes back to be redrawn.

Next steps

  1. Before you write, ask the town's Planning and Building Department which zones the parcel falls in. Three things: which geologic zones cover this address (fault, landslide, expansive bedrock, liquefaction), how the fault setback is drawn on the map, and whether the town's files already hold a historical soils or geologic report for the site. Los Altos Hills expressly retains soils reports in town records, and Portola Valley and Woodside both hold site-level material. None of it usually appears in the MLS attachment package.
  2. Write the geologic and geotechnical investigation as its own contingency, with time budgeted to the town's review rhythm. Do not let it sit inside a generic property investigation period. If you have an addition or rebuild in mind, rough out the grading volume and cut/fill depths first and read them against Woodside's three thresholds — 100 cubic yards / 3 feet of fill / 4 feet of cut (site development permit), 100 to 1,000 and above 1,000 cubic yards (the report and peer-review tiers), and 1,500 cubic yards or 8 feet (Planning Commission) — to see how far up the ladder your scheme goes.
  3. Have an architect or land consultant produce a buildable-envelope drawing before you decide on price. Overlay setbacks, landslide zones and slope constraints on the parcel map, and see whether what is left holds the scheme you actually want. This step costs a small fraction of redrawing after closing, and what it tells you changes your valuation of the land directly.
  4. Call your insurance broker the same week the offer is accepted, and run wildfire and earthquake in parallel. Ask for a written comparison of CEA and non-CEA options: available deductible tiers (remembering that above a $1,000,000 Coverage A limit only 15%, 20% and 25% remain), the dollar deductible those tiers produce against your rebuilding-cost limit, and the premium. The §10083 clock — 30 days of silence presumed to be a rejection — starts running around your closing. Do not let it expire during moving week.
